The Reed & Barton Williamsburg series was introduced in
2007 and is inspired by Colonial Williamsburg. Now in
its 9th Edition, the 2015 Reed & Barton North Pole Bound Sterling Ornament is beautifully handcrafted by skilled silversmiths in the USA. Infused with the spirit of colonial American_Heritageican's cultural capital, the Williamsburg series embodies beautiful eighteenth-century Colonial Williamsburg decorative traditions. Bordered by an oval twist of sterling, this charming ornament features a graceful reindeer leaping above snow covered pines. Each ornament is masterfully crafted with unmatched attention to detail. Proceeds help support the preservation, research, and education programs of the Colonial Williamsburg Foundation, the non-profit organization that oversees the restored colonial capital in Williamsburg, Virginia. Original factory gift box, protective velvet pouch, brochure, and ribbon are all included. The ornament is engraved Reed & Barton Williamsburg Sterling on the reverse, is two-sided, and measures 3.3" wide. This ornament is not dated.
